Job Description

Job Title: Multiskilled Engineer Department: Engineering & Maintenance Location: Wolverhampton Reporting To: Engineering Manager Overview An established manufacturing organisation is seeking a skilled Electrically Biased Multiskilled Engineer to support the ongoing maintenance and optimisation of high-volume production equipment. This role is critical in ensuring operational efficiency, minimising downtime, and supporting continuous improvement initiatives across the site. Qualifications & Experience * Recognised electrical engineering qualification (e.g. City & Guilds, HNC, or equivalent), or demonstrable hands-on experience at an equivalent level * Proven background in electrical maintenance within a high-volume manufacturing or production environment * Some working knowledge of PLC systems, including Siemens S7 and/or Allen Bradley * Multi-skilled capability with a willingness to support mechanical maintenance activities where required Key Responsibilities * Carry out planned and reactive maintenance on production machinery to maximise uptime and efficiency * Complete all maintenance documentation, data recording, and reporting accurately and within required timeframes * Perform preventative maintenance and condition-based monitoring activities * Interpret electrical and mechanical schematics and technical drawings * Support installation and upgrade projects, including cabling, containment systems, and electrical infrastructure * Work with systems involving pneumatics, hydraulics, and PLC controls * Maintain compliance with all health, safety, and environmental standards *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ives and operational best practice * Provide cross-functional support to other maintenance personnel when required * Participate in training and development to remain compliant with current legislation and industry standards * Communicate effectively across all levels of the business * Support shift cover, overtime, and call-out requirements as needed Skills & Competencies * Strong fault-finding and problem-solving ability * Ability to work independently and under pressure in a fast-paced environment * Team-oriented with the ability to support and influence others * Good numerical and IT skills, including maintenance management systems * Flexible, proactive, and committed to ongoing learning and development Technical Knowledge * Electrical systems and wiring regulations * PLC fault finding and basic programming awareness * Pneumatics and hydraulics (basic level) * Fabrication and basic welding (desirable) * General mechanical fitting skills Working Environment This role operates within a fast-paced, results-driven manufacturing environment. The successful candidate will demonstrate: * Strong decision-making capability * Clear and effective communication skills * A flexible and proactive approach aligned with business objectives Working Hours Shift Pattern: Perm Days within each 1 in 3 rotation at weekends on call. Salary & Benefits Base Salary: £44,725.96 per annum
